ISLAMABAD The Government on Tuesday finalised two high profile appointments namely Chief Secretary Sindh and Governor State Bank of Pakistan, well-placed officials sources confirmed to TheNation. According to sources, Prime Minister Yousuf Raza Gilani has approved posting of Secretary Petroleum and Natural Resources Kamran Lashari as Chief Secretary Sindh. Consequent upon the PMs approval, the Establishment Division has also issued a notification in this regard. Lashari is most likely to take charge of his assignment on Wednesday (today). The PM Secretariat issued a late night press release stating, Prime Minister Syed Yousuf Raza Gilani has approved the appointment of Kamran Lashari as Chief Secretary, Government of Sindh, with immediate effect. Kamran Lashari was serving as Secretary Ministry of Petroleum and Natural Resources. Regarding the appointment of Shahid Hafeez Kardar as Governor State Bank of Pakistan, the Prime Minister Secretariat has sent the summary proposal to the Presidency, the sources said. Since the President was away and reached back from Sindh late Tuesday evening, he could not take up the latest communications from Prime Ministers Secretariat, said Farhatullah Babar, the Spokesman to the President. Earlier sources told TheNation that the President, too, had approved, in principle, the appointment of Kardar as Governor SBP and formalities would be fulfilled on Wednesday. The sources were of the view that notification in this regard was most likely to be issued on Wednesday enabling Kardar to take charge before Eid holidays.
